Commit Graph

  • f890ffa8cd Merge pull request #54 from mailvelope/fix-travis-mongo Thomas Oberndörfer 2017-10-17 10:23:35 +0200
  • b3a2171a72 Fix mongo config Tankred Hase 2017-10-17 10:17:54 +0200
  • 384884b9f6 chore(package): update mocha to version 4.0.1 greenkeeper[bot] 2017-10-06 03:24:54 +0000
  • 632f1ccc0f chore(package): update mocha to version 4.0.0 greenkeeper[bot] 2017-10-03 04:48:32 +0000
  • d80108915e Merge pull request #47 from mailvelope/dev/fix-parsing Tankred Hase 2017-08-27 16:54:34 +0800
  • b1848bf8e6 Use co-body directly instead of koa-body (which uses co-body under the hood) Tankred Hase 2017-08-27 16:32:25 +0800
  • 1de83fe5d5 Merge pull request #46 from mailvelope/dev/key-update Tankred Hase 2017-08-25 16:27:06 +0800
  • b93db84c6a Optimize key removal during verification Tankred Hase 2017-08-25 16:20:33 +0800
  • 77fc0fd195 Cleanup purge old keys Tankred Hase 2017-08-25 16:11:35 +0800
  • b738e1bc5c Allow update of an email address’ key with remove/verify flow in between Tankred Hase 2017-08-24 16:36:32 +0800
  • 164585b406 Don’t use build@mailvelople.com for travis notifications. Tankred Hase 2017-08-24 14:19:19 +0800
  • 2b969c0382 Merge pull request #45 from mailvelope/dev/remove-primaryEmail-param Tankred Hase 2017-08-24 14:13:26 +0800
  • 0400b9c9d9 Fix test Tankred Hase 2017-08-24 13:26:39 +0800
  • 743a5aeb75 Double quote escaping not required for ES6 templates Tankred Hase 2017-08-19 17:58:13 +0800
  • db8f4925b9 Fix integration tests for verification email matching Tankred Hase 2017-08-19 17:52:15 +0800
  • 6022e03980 Fix typo in email docs Tankred Hase 2017-08-19 17:17:33 +0800
  • 88385cd27b Fix email unit test Tankred Hase 2017-08-19 17:17:22 +0800
  • 09e6aed176 Upgrade to nodermailer@^4.0.1 Tankred Hase 2017-08-19 17:07:13 +0800
  • 82348498df Send email message with PGP inline not PGP/MIME * Use OpenPGP.js directly instead of nodemailer-openpgp plugin * Use native ES6 string templates instead of nodemailer template engine Tankred Hase 2017-08-19 17:06:36 +0800
  • b74563b3ec Remove primaryEmail parameter from README Tankred Hase 2017-08-23 18:20:22 +0800
  • 5fa36e6d52 Remove primaryEmail parameter from REST api. Tankred Hase 2017-08-23 18:19:59 +0800
  • 4c28da4eab Add uploaded attribute to documentation. Tankred Hase 2017-08-23 18:09:54 +0800
  • 1e2c85621b Remove primaryEmail parameter from public-key service. Tankred Hase 2017-08-23 18:08:18 +0800
  • aa850377d5 Ignore config/development.js Tankred Hase 2017-08-24 12:48:06 +0800
  • 0d6a9fdae5 Use log level env var instead of environment config Tankred Hase 2017-08-23 18:31:15 +0800
  • 258117d36d Merge pull request #44 from mailvelope/dev/purge-old-unverified-keys Tankred Hase 2017-08-22 15:31:09 +0800
  • 5b86a77338 Delete redundant test Tankred Hase 2017-08-22 15:29:18 +0800
  • fe55578268 Remove legacy support since all documents now have an uploaded flag. Tankred Hase 2017-08-22 15:26:15 +0800
  • 2af8310070 Purge old/unverified keys or keys without an uploaded attribute. Tankred Hase 2017-08-22 12:13:15 +0800
  • afacbf413f Add uploaded date attribute to PGP key document in MongoDB Tankred Hase 2017-08-22 11:26:12 +0800
  • 74063915c7 Remove NODE_ENV environment var in nom scripts Tankred Hase 2017-08-18 21:36:55 +0800
  • 80c760681c Merge pull request #42 from mailvelope/dev/papertrail Tankred Hase 2017-08-18 18:25:10 +0800
  • ba6f75984e Integrate winston-papertrail plugin Tankred Hase 2017-08-18 18:04:43 +0800
  • 35dbc08015 Use winston instead of npmlog Tankred Hase 2017-08-18 18:01:34 +0800
  • a156f05002 Update README Tankred Hase 2017-08-17 20:02:38 +0800
  • e3a2a1ff20 Rename demo.html -> ui.html Tankred Hase 2017-08-17 19:53:22 +0800
  • 7f5ad65c61 Merge pull request #41 from mailvelope/dev/app-refactor Tankred Hase 2017-08-17 19:34:01 +0800
  • 7d3a64c84d Stub log output in public-key integration test Tankred Hase 2017-08-17 19:28:08 +0800
  • 95ff2d9247 Cleanup app/init/koa-middlewares Tankred Hase 2017-08-17 19:16:49 +0800
  • 8c76281666 Merge pull request #40 from mailvelope/dev/async-await Tankred Hase 2017-08-17 17:46:49 +0800
  • a52cef2771 Add space after async in async () => Tankred Hase 2017-08-17 17:44:26 +0800
  • 47f8f1c8b9 Merge 2192db1ec5 into 158a7418d0 greenkeeper[bot] 2017-08-17 09:27:59 +0000
  • 4081463dfa Migrate HKP api Tankred Hase 2017-08-17 15:37:59 +0800
  • 49b24a5cb4 Migrate to koa 2 Refactor rest api to async/await Tankred Hase 2017-08-17 15:34:47 +0800
  • 3dfa447fcf Revert resolves/rejects changes in email unit test. Tankred Hase 2017-08-16 17:57:33 +0800
  • 1557a5f925 Migrate public-key service to async/await Tankred Hase 2017-08-16 17:55:32 +0800
  • 59a77fd01e Go back to sinon v1.x for now due to failing tests. Tankred Hase 2017-08-16 17:39:55 +0800
  • 5778f8fa13 Migrate pgp-test to sinon sandbox Tankred Hase 2017-08-16 16:55:28 +0800
  • ba671126db Migrate email module Tankred Hase 2017-08-16 12:27:03 +0800
  • 874903c64b Migrate mongo DAO Tankred Hase 2017-08-16 12:03:32 +0800
  • 26807e03b1 Remove co-mocha from test setup Tankred Hase 2017-08-16 11:50:03 +0800
  • 5ecc728564 Update dependencies for koa 2 and async/await Tankred Hase 2017-08-16 11:49:43 +0800
  • 7178a12ed5 Activate ES2017 in eslint to allow async/await Tankred Hase 2017-08-16 11:43:44 +0800
  • 158a7418d0 Merge pull request #39 from mailvelope/dev/eslint Tankred Hase 2017-08-15 16:38:10 +0800
  • 20593a0adc Revert static/demo.js since it is not transpiled Tankred Hase 2017-08-15 16:32:50 +0800
  • 21118c0b1d Fix string in hkp Tankred Hase 2017-08-15 16:27:12 +0800
  • c773da3f60 Fix config/development.js Tankred Hase 2017-08-15 16:19:31 +0800
  • 80a8028f86 Remove jshint and jscs configs Tankred Hase 2017-08-15 16:14:21 +0800
  • d8039ea976 Stub npmlog in integration tests Tankred Hase 2017-08-15 16:12:51 +0800
  • e9251d5203 Fix eslint errors Tankred Hase 2017-08-15 16:03:06 +0800
  • 750cf3d897 Use eslint instead of jscs/jshint Add .eslint.rc and test/.eslint.rc Tankred Hase 2017-08-15 15:22:15 +0800
  • f224f32e66 Merge pull request #38 from mailvelope/dev/travis-aws-deploy Tankred Hase 2017-08-14 19:34:27 +0800
  • 7800dafce3 Remove .elasticbeanstalk/config.yml and shell script for local deployment Tankred Hase 2017-08-14 19:30:23 +0800
  • bbf24d6c53 Add AWS Elastic Beanstalk deployment plugin to travis config Run npm release script before deployment Upgrade to node v8 in travis job Tankred Hase 2017-08-14 19:29:16 +0800
  • b9380f9f20 Add release npm script for travis deployment Tankred Hase 2017-08-14 19:27:21 +0800
  • ffbee07c5c Ignore compatible upgrades to sinon. Closes #26 Tankred Hase 2017-08-14 16:01:27 +0800
  • 73a36d9b91 Merge 1fc0d608d9 into eb9ecea7e5 Tankred Hase 2017-08-14 05:11:00 +0000
  • 1fc0d608d9 Merge branch 'master' into greenkeeper/sinon-2.3.8 Tankred Hase 2017-08-14 13:10:58 +0800
  • 96af9cf45d Merge 02f0ef0a15 into eb9ecea7e5 Tankred Hase 2017-08-14 04:28:56 +0000
  • 02f0ef0a15 Merge branch 'master' into greenkeeper/sinon-3.2.0 Tankred Hase 2017-08-14 12:28:55 +0800
  • eb9ecea7e5 Merge pull request #35 from mailvelope/greenkeeper/chai-4.1.1 Tankred Hase 2017-08-14 12:24:47 +0800
  • cdbf6c940c Merge 2c2c00788d into 2db8127931 greenkeeper[bot] 2017-08-14 04:20:12 +0000
  • 2db8127931 Merge pull request #34 from mailvelope/greenkeeper/co-body-5.1.1 Tankred Hase 2017-08-14 12:20:03 +0800
  • 64292ef802 Merge be016883ee into b397fa00cd greenkeeper[bot] 2017-08-14 04:19:31 +0000
  • b397fa00cd Ignore incompatible nodemailer updates. Nodemailer v3+ no longer has an internal template engine. Closes #20 Tankred Hase 2017-08-14 12:18:16 +0800
  • 252053dd13 Ignore npm v5+ package-lock.json to let greenkeeper monitor updates. Tankred Hase 2017-08-14 12:05:33 +0800
  • d7ef68cd97 Merge pull request #19 from mailvelope/greenkeeper/supertest-3.0.0 Tankred Hase 2017-08-14 12:02:09 +0800
  • 5fc6ab6cde Merge 66d22d4019 into 469afdac91 greenkeeper[bot] 2017-08-14 04:00:03 +0000
  • 469afdac91 Update to current mongoldb driver Tankred Hase 2017-08-14 11:57:55 +0800
  • 9f922ce116 Merge pull request #16 from mailvelope/npm_script Tankred Hase 2017-08-14 11:51:27 +0800
  • b721dc9f9b Merge pull request #17 from mailvelope/node_v6 Tankred Hase 2017-08-14 11:43:54 +0800
  • 302048b5e2 chore(package): update sinon to version 3.2.0 greenkeeper[bot] 2017-08-10 14:39:47 +0000
  • 505b337d9a chore(package): update chai to version 4.1.1 greenkeeper[bot] 2017-08-05 07:58:26 +0000
  • 998f58d334 chore(package): update sinon to version 2.3.8 greenkeeper[bot] 2017-07-13 08:24:12 +0000
  • 2c2c00788d chore(package): update chai to version 4.0.2 greenkeeper[bot] 2017-06-05 19:52:45 +0000
  • d294ec2fd0 fix(package): update koa-router to version 7.1.1 greenkeeper[bot] 2017-04-01 12:14:33 +0000
  • b2455393b2 fix(package): update co-body to version 5.1.1 greenkeeper[bot] 2017-03-24 03:31:00 +0000
  • 66d22d4019 chore(package): update sinon to version 2.0.0 greenkeeper[bot] 2017-03-15 06:30:56 +0000
  • be016883ee fix(package): update co-body to version 5.0.0 greenkeeper[bot] 2017-03-01 17:03:45 +0000
  • ddc4196c1f fix(package): update koa-static to version 3.0.0 greenkeeper[bot] 2017-02-26 11:35:00 +0000
  • 2192db1ec5 fix(package): update koa to version 2.0.1 greenkeeper[bot] 2017-02-25 06:48:28 +0000
  • 2c3ceb6b3f Merge 0b6fcdff67 into 2fcedd9f09 greenkeeper[bot] 2017-01-31 10:17:48 +0000
  • 0b6fcdff67 fix(package): update nodemailer to version 3.0.0 greenkeeper[bot] 2017-01-31 10:17:44 +0000
  • 9898383230 chore(package): update supertest to version 3.0.0 greenkeeper[bot] 2017-01-30 00:24:15 +0000
  • cb37c834d8 Remove grunt from travis.yml Tankred Hase 2017-01-21 12:16:03 +0000
  • a47a0162a6 Use ES6 destructuring (not available in node v4) Tankred Hase 2017-01-21 11:51:33 +0000
  • 5674a2e8c9 Replace grunt with npm scripts Tankred Hase 2017-01-21 11:30:26 +0000
  • 2fcedd9f09 Merge pull request #15 from mailvelope/greenkeeper/update-all Tankred Hase 2017-01-20 19:24:13 +0000
  • 07c6ccd717 Upgrade node versions Tankred Hase 2017-01-20 19:19:15 +0000
  • 41cd62668b Revert back to koa-router@5.x Tankred Hase 2017-01-20 19:17:50 +0000